Heim  >  Artikel  >  Datenbank  >  oracle 同义词

oracle 同义词

WBOY
WBOYOriginal
2016-06-07 15:25:451312Durchsuche

Oracle数据库中提供了同义词管理的功能。同义词是数据库方案对象的一个别名,经常用于简化对象访问和提高对象访问的安全性。在使用同义词时,Oracle数据库将它翻译成对应方案对象的名字。与视图类似,同义词并不占用实际存储空间,只有在数据字典中保存了同

Oracle数据库中提供了同义词管理的功能。同义词是数据库方案对象的一个别名,经常用于简化对象访问和提高对象访问的安全性。在使用同义词 时,Oracle数据库将它翻译成对应方案对象的名字。与视图类似,同义词并不占用实际存储空间,只有在数据字典中保存了同义词的定义。在Oracle数 据库中的大部分数据库对象,如表、视图、同义词、序列、存储过程、函数、JAVA类、包等等,数据库管理员都可以根据实际情况为他们定义同义词。通过 Oracle数据库同义词管理,可以给数据库管理员与应用程序开发人员带来不少惊喜。

  --注意:在创建公有同义词的时候,只允许有dba权限的用户才能创建

//为scott用户下的emp表创建私有同义词
create synonym tempsy for scott.emp;--其中tempsy为同义词名称可以自定义

 

 

//为scott用户下的emp表创建公有同义词--其中publicsy为同义词名称
create public synonym publicsy for scott.emp;

 

--删除同义词

drop synonym tempsy;

drop public synonym publicsy;

 

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Vorheriger Artikel:查询SQLSERVER执行过的SQL记录Nächster Artikel:vs2010 c++ 链接mysql